/** * @param FormBuilderInterface $builder * @param array $options */ public function buildForm(FormBuilderInterface $builder, array $options) { parent::buildForm($builder, $options); $builder->get('studies')->add('validatedLevel', 'entity', array('label' => 'user.professor.field.validated_level', 'constraints' => array(new NotBlank()))); }
/** * @param FormBuilderInterface $builder * @param array $options */ public function buildForm(FormBuilderInterface $builder, array $options) { parent::buildForm($builder, $options); $builder->get('studies')->add('school', 'text', array('label' => 'user.student.field.school', 'constraints' => array(new NotBlank())))->add('level', 'entity', array('class' => 'Mathsup\\ExerciseBundle\\Entity\\Level', 'label' => 'user.student.field.level', 'constraints' => array(new NotBlank())))->add('repeatedLevels', 'entity', array('required' => false, 'label' => 'user.student.field.repeated_levels', 'class' => 'Mathsup\\ExerciseBundle\\Entity\\Level', 'multiple' => true)); }